Legit question here. How do I get the genesis core for the sengoku driver? I only just got into gaim and just bought a used sengoku driver. I have a few DX lockseeds, but I really want to hear that Mix function. Where do I get one shuki? Where did you get yours?
This thing right here: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=wCR85aAd_vk The one and only way of getting it, since that is where it belongs.Mr. S of CSToys has been able to find used Genesis Cores separately, but Genesis Drivers don't go for too much on the aftermarket, you're better off just getting the full thing to get full use out of your Energy Lockseeds.

but if the cs Ryuki belt cards are toy sized, then how is the belt a 1:1 replica to the show if the cards are not 1:1?
From what I understand, there is a difference between 1:1 between cards and the belt. The cards in the show were larger (to better be shown on screen) compared to the ones used when interacting with the belt. The CS Belt is 1:1 to those that interacted with the belt, while the card Archives are 1:1 with the card props used independently in the show.
